Purpose of Job:
The All Battery Product Manager will serve as the subject matter expert for assigned All Battery product categories. They will take the lead in product strategy execution, provide technical support, and work with suppliers to develop new products to meet market needs.
Job Components:
Executeproduct line strategy to support the vision and strategy of the overall All Battery product category
Execute product development steps with suppliers, quality,purchasing,and category managerto meet the needs of new product projects
Support the business with technicalexpertise
Answer research requests (sales and store questions) in a complete andtimelymanner
Coordinate with quality toapproveand disqualifyproducts from multiple sources to helpeliminatesupply risksandmaintainquality
Own the line review process to manageproduct life cycles and support category strategy
Ensure product meets all applicable environmentalandlegalrequirements and thatrequired product certifications are obtained
Support and implement Environmental, Social, Governance (ESG) initiatives, as assigned
SupportAll Battery RFQ with productexpertiseinputandawardrecommendations
Ensureproductcross references,SAPproduct data,product specsheetsand product portal aremaintainedwithaccurateinformation
Ensure accuracy of product information entered on new product PCN
Supports All Battey Marketing in the development of product catalogs
Utilize supplier relationships to understandproduct updates andnew technologies
Ensure products meet the requirements of our ISO 13485 Quality Management System (QMS)
Meet with suppliers in coordination with procurement as needed
Qualifications:
Bachleor’s degree in Marketing or related field required
Minimum of 5 years of experience in product management
Effective communicator (oral and written)
Proven track record of collaborating and working with a cross-functional team
Strong problem solver with the ability to think outside the box
Able to work independently with proper levels of prioritization and follow through
Ability to multi-task while being detail oriented under minimal supervision
Proven analytical capability
Proficientin Microsoft Office
